二氧化钒粉体的制备及其应用研究

摘要:

二氧化钒(VO2)在相变温度68℃附近具有良好的半导体-金属相变(MIT)特性,在相变的同时光学及电学等性能也随之发生改变。本文简要介绍了VO2光学和电学性能,综述了现阶段VO2粉体的制备方法及其应用的研究进展。

关键词: VO2; 粉体; 制备; 应用;
Abstract:

VO2 has a fully reversible semiconductor-metal phase transition(MIT) at 68 ℃. Associated with the phase transition, the optical and electrical properties of VO2 are considerably changed. In this paper, we brief introduce the optical, electrical properties of VO2, and the research progress of preparation and application of VO2 powder are summarized.
